How accurate are cryptocurrency price forecasts?

Cryptocurrency price forecasts have limited accuracy, even from experienced analysts. The crypto market is highly volatile and influenced by unpredictable factors like regulatory news, social media trends, and macroeconomic events. Studies show that most price predictions, including those using technical analysis or AI models, perform only slightly better than random guessing over longer timeframes. Short-term forecasts (hours to days) tend to be more reliable than long-term ones (months to years). Professional traders use forecasts as one tool among many, combining technical analysis, market sentiment, and risk management rather than relying on predictions alone. Always remember: past performance doesn't guarantee future results, and no forecast is certain.
